Miss Grant Takes Richmond
1949 NR COMEDY 1h 27min
CAST— Lucille Ball, William Holden, Janis Carter, James Gleason, Frank McHugh
MUSIC— Heinz Roemheld DIRECTOR— Lloyd Bacon
Another ditsy performance by Lucille Ball is the highlight in an otherwise forgettable film. Inept secretary Ball is hired on by a realtor, despite having no talent in the workplace. What Ball fails to realize is that her new employer is a big time bookie. When she begins a campaign to organize a project for low cost housing, she just may steer her crooked boss legit. Some funny bits (mostly involving a typewriter) are scattered throughout this so-so farce. AKA Innocence is Bliss.
OUR RATING— **
